Cost of Living: Mount Prospect, IL vs Houston, TX
Quick rent-and-take-home comparison
Using a baseline of $70,000/yr gross, take-home is about $4,227/mo in Mount Prospect, IL versus $4,516/mo in Houston, TX. In the model, rent is about 21.19% of gross in Mount Prospect, IL versus 19.13% in Houston, TX, so Houston, TX tends to feel more affordable for rent.

Cost of Living Index
Mount Prospect, IL: 100 (U.S. = 100) · Houston, TX: 92.1 (U.S. = 100)
Houston, TX has a lower cost-of-living index than Mount Prospect, IL, so a given salary generally stretches further there.
Median Rent
Mount Prospect, IL: $1,382/mo (midpoint of 1BR/2BR) · Houston, TX: $1,248/mo
Median rent in Mount Prospect, IL is $134/mo higher than in Houston, TX.
Median Home Price
Mount Prospect, IL: $377,000 · Houston, TX: $253,400
Median home price in Mount Prospect, IL is $123,600 higher than in Houston, TX.
Median Household Income
Mount Prospect, IL: $103,911 · Houston, TX: $62,894
Mount Prospect, IL has a higher median household income than Houston, TX by $41,017.
